How I make my morning coffee: college edition!

Hi everyone! As we all know, college is tiring, and I wouldn’t be able to get through my days without a morning coffee! This is my step by step on how I make mine. I start by filling my cup with ice, and adding just a bit of milk to the bottom of my cup. Then, since I don’t have a coffee machine, I put Nespresso powder and maple syrup in a cup, heat up water, and then froth it together! Then, I make my cold foam by mixing my cookie dough creamer (my favorite) and whipping cream and frothing it to make it fluffy.
